Through our programs and services, we step in to help our neighbors renovate their homes, and in the process, their lives, in partnership with sponsors, in-kind donors and volunteers. Our team efforts aid the elderly, disabled and low-income families in our community who own their homes, but because of age, physical limitations and low or fixed incomes, are not able to address their housing repairs themselves. Community non-profit facilities are also beneficiaries of our efforts at no cost to the recipients. On each sponsored project, enthusiastic volunteers, both professional tradesman and unskilled individuals, arm themselves with truckloads of building materials and giving spirits. In a team effort they paint, re-carpet, landscape, clean-up and perform plumbing and electrical repairs. This grassroots effort brings people together for one common cause; the hands-on experience allows one to see the immediate gratification of your efforts of making a significant difference in someone else’s life. In 2005 we acquired a warehouse and office facility in Logan Heights. Our new headquarters has facilitated the develop of a year round program and our ability to serve those in need in our community. On a National Level
In 1983, Christmas in April came to Washington D.C. after a reporter witnessed the Midland program and was overwhelmed by what he saw. A national program was launched in 1988 as Christmas in April USA. This effort has spread, changing its name to Rebuilding Together in 2001 to be more synonymous with the work we do in the community in 865 cities and towns in 50 states with more than 240 affiliates nationwide.
